26 /// IncludeDirGroup - Identifies the group an include Entry belongs to,
27 /// representing its relative positive in the search list.
28 /// \#include directives whose paths are enclosed by string quotes ("")
29 /// start searching at the Quoted group (specified by '-iquote'),
30 /// then search the Angled group, then the System group, etc.
31 enum IncludeDirGroup {
32 /// '\#include ""' paths, added by 'gcc -iquote'.
35 /// Paths for '\#include <>' added by '-I'.
38 /// Like Angled, but marks header maps used when building frameworks.
41 /// Like Angled, but marks system directories.
44 /// Like System, but headers are implicitly wrapped in extern "C".
47 /// Like System, but only used for C.
50 /// Like System, but only used for C++.
53 /// Like System, but only used for ObjC.
56 /// Like System, but only used for ObjC++.
59 /// Like System, but searched after the system directories.

145 /// The interval (in seconds) between pruning operations.
147 /// This operation is expensive, because it requires Clang to walk through
148 /// the directory structure of the module cache, stat()'ing and removing
151 /// The default value is large, e.g., the operation runs once a week.
152 unsigned ModuleCachePruneInterval = 7 * 24 * 60 * 60;
154 /// The time (in seconds) after which an unused module file will be
155 /// considered unused and will, therefore, be pruned.
157 /// When the module cache is pruned, any module file that has not been
158 /// accessed in this many seconds will be removed. The default value is
159 /// large, e.g., a month, to avoid forcing infrequently-used modules to be
160 /// regenerated often.
161 unsigned ModuleCachePruneAfter = 31 * 24 * 60 * 60;
